$32.99 new price for Hasbro Action Figures
 
It seems all the major sites have figures, new and old, at $32.99. That is pushing the limits I think, will this stop anyone from collecting?

Re: $32.99 new price for Figures
 
You mean that sudden price increase over at Amazon? Seems at least that neither TRU or Walmart have increased their prices, ML and Black Series and the rest remain at 29.99, McFarlane figures remain at 24.99, etc.

Re: $32.99 new price for Figures
 
EB has always been pricing things a bit higher than normal, just like Gamestop in the US. For example McFarlane's Warhammer figures were $24.99 at TRU and Amazon, while at EB they were $34.99. I think once TRU and Walmart price their items this way, then we'll have to worry about a permanent price increase. Pretty sure most of Hasbro's figures did recently get a new MSRP of 21.49, though that price isn't reflected on Pulse, so not sure when that was supposed to come into effect.
